This project was submitted as a Bachelor's final year project with the title of:
This project was created to develop an android application which helps user to locate different other users/friends with the feature called location sharing mode. Real time location sharing and alert service is available with the help cloud database (firebase). The location sharing mode of a particular user if is turned on then the connected users can view the location of that user. The users have an option for turning off the location sharing mode. While tracking other user, the tracking user can create a boundary on the map that acts as a geo-fence for the tracked user. If the tracked user gets inside or outside the boundary i.e. geo-fence, the tracking user gets notification.
To follow some other user, the currently logged in user needs to enter the invitation code provided by the other user.
If a user is added as a friend, then that user can be viewed in the follower section with their location